Episode 1 of Big Roles, Quiet Minds kicks off with a question we all hear constantly — and almost never answer honestly: “So… how are you really doing?” You know the moment: someone asks, you say “I’m good!” automatically, and your brain quietly says, “Well… it’s complicated.” In this first episode, we talk about the gap between the polished version of ourselves and the real one juggling stress, expectations, overthinking, and the occasional existential spiral before lunch. It’s a light, honest conversation about emotional check-ins, why strong and capable people often keep things to themselves, and how slowing down for a minute can actually feel revolutionary. No heavy jargon, no perfect answers — just relatable reflections, gentle humor, and a reminder that you’re definitely not the only one figuring things out as you go.
